Biography

Zhu Qunxi is engaged in researches on complex networks and deep learning, and his related results have been published in the top international journals such as IEEE TAC, SICON, SCL, CHAOS and ICLR 2021. These papers received reviews and citations from peers (Edward Ott, Jurgen Kurths, Cao Jinde, GUI Weihua and other academicians, teams from Google Research and UC Berkeley, etc.)
